c語言賦值規(guī)則

發(fā)布時間:2025-09-30 01:01:14 瀏覽次數(shù):16

C語言中的賦值規(guī)則如下:

1. 賦值符號為“=”。

2. 賦值順序是從右往左計算,即先計算等號右邊的表達(dá)式,再將結(jié)果賦給等號左邊的變量。

3. 變量的類型必須與表達(dá)式的類型兼容。

4. 賦值運算符的優(yōu)先級較低,通常需要使用括號明確表達(dá)式的計算順序。

5. 復(fù)合賦值運算符(如“+=”、“-=”等)可以簡化賦值操作,例如“a+=1”相當(dāng)于“a=a+1”。

6. 賦值運算具有右結(jié)合性,即賦值運算符從右向左依次執(zhí)行,例如“a=b=c=10”相當(dāng)于“c=10;b=c;a=b;”。

需要注意的是,賦值語句中不能使用常量作為左值,因為常量是只讀的,無法改變其值。

c語言賦值語句規(guī)則
需要裝修報建?需要辦理施工許可證?歡迎咨詢客戶經(jīng)理 18221559551